About Enchant Boots - Greater Fortitude

Enchant Boots - Greater Fortitude is a trade good in World of Warcraft. No recipe taught by a player profession in the current game build consumes it, so its price is driven by demand outside the crafting economy - vendors, quests, or collectors - rather than by any craft. This page tracks the verified Auction House price and supply so you can judge whether it is worth farming or selling right now.

To read the chart: compare the current lowest listing against the typical range. A price sitting below its recent band is a buy or craft signal; a price above it favors selling or farming. The method matters more than any single number, since commodity prices move between hourly snapshots.
